Jaguars Remain Undefeated In 74-64 Win At Shaw

RALEIGH, N.C. – The GRU Augusta men's basketball team were outrebounded and outscored at the free-throw line, but the Jaguars withstood the Shaw Bears on the road to win a 74-64 non-conference game Saturday afternoon in the CC Spaulding Gymasium.

The Jaguars (5-0) stayed undefeated as senior Devonte Thomas scored his season-high 17 points and sophomore Keith Crump matched his season-high with 13 points against the Shaw Bears (2-3).

Freshman Vlad Cobzaru started off the day with two made free throws and a jump shot to give the Jags a two-basket lead. Shaw's John Savoy put the Bears on the board for the first time with a made free throw and eventually tipped in a missed Shaw shot to even the game at six-all.

GRU got some perimeter work from Keith Crump and Devonte Thomas in the first half - with each sinking three pointers for a 12-8 lead at the 15:03 mark, but the Bears fought back and got to the free-throw line to tie the contest at 12 and 15. Another Savoy layup sparked an 8-0 Shaw run, giving them their first and largest lead of the game.

GRU point guards D'Angelo Boyce and Keshun Sherrill continued to find Crump, who drained back-to-back three balls for a 25-all score with 3:50 remaining in the opening half. Crump had three treys on the day.

Savoy knocked down two more Shaw free throws to give the Bears a slight lead that was spoiled by Jaguar senior Devon Wright-Nelson's three-point play – giving GRU a one-point advantage with the clocking expiring. Shaw stayed persistent of the charity stripe and knocked down more free throws to give them a 33-32 lead at the break.

Crump hit three from beyond arc in the first half as the Jags hit 5-of-10 three pointers, while Shaw was 0-for-4. The Bears however, hit 21 free throws to GRU's three in the first 20 minutes and outrebounded the Jags 21-to-8.

Shaw's Jamar Cooper and GRU's Keshun Sherrill traded baskets to begin the second half, but the Jags held the lead for five minutes. With 11:37 on the clock, Ali Baba Odd nailed a game-tying three pointer to make it 41-all. Sherrill responded with a three and jumper to keep GRU ahead and under 10 minutes to play, Henry McCarthy gave more life with two tip-in baskets. Odd cut it back to a one-point game with two free throws, but he committed a foul on Boyce which resulted in two Jaguar points at the charity stripe.

Devonte Thomas lifted the Jags to a five-point lead with two more three pointers as GRU slowly increased the advantage – forcing Shaw to put the Jags on the free-throw line. GRU held off the Bears for a 74-64 win, shooting 46.3 percent from the field to Shaw's 36.6 percent. Shaw dominated the paint at the charity stripe for the game, winning the rebound contest 41-25 and scoring 33 points on free throws to GRU's 15.

Last time out against Shaw on Nov. 23, 2014, GRU Augusta outscored Shaw 23-12 over the final 9:10 and registered a 74-69 non-conference road win Saturday afternoon in the Spaulding Gymnasium.
